Phantosmia (phantom smells)
Some people can detect a metallic smell or other odors that can't be smelled by anyone else around them because the smells aren't real. This condition is called phantosmia, an olfactory hallucination that's often triggered by a sinus condition.

Phantosmia is the medical word doctors use when a person smells something that is not actually there. The smells vary from person to person but are usually unpleasant, such as burnt toast, metallic, or chemical smells. Phantosmia is also called a phantom smell or an olfactory hallucination.Can anxiety make you smell things?
Phantom SmellPhantosmia, which is an olfactory hallucination, sometimes occurs with anxiety. It can cause you to smell something that isn't there, or rather, a neutral smell becomes unpleasant.

Could it be a brain tumor? Your olfactory complex, which is what allows your brain to process smells, is in your frontal and temporal lobe. If you have a tumor in the frontal or temporal lobe, it can distort your smell system and lead to you smelling things that aren't there.What is the smell of copper?
